Q: Is 491,472 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 491,472 is a composite number.

Why is 491,472 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 491,472 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 16 18 24 36 48 72 144 3,413 6,826 10,239 13,652 20,478 27,304 30,717 40,956 54,608 61,434 81,912 122,868 163,824 245,736 and 491,472, with no remainder.

Since 491,472 cannot be divided by just 1 and 491,472, it is a composite number.
